What is a senior motor design engineer?

A Senior Motor Design Engineer is responsible for designing, developing, and optimizing electric motors for various applications, such as automotive, industrial, and consumer electronics. They analyze performance requirements, select materials, and oversee simulations and prototyping to ensure efficiency and reliability. Additionally, they collaborate with cross-functional teams, including mechanical and electrical engineers, to integrate motors into complete systems. Their role often involves troubleshooting design issues, improving manufacturing processes, and staying updated with advancements in motor technology.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the senior motor design engineer position, and why are they important?

A Senior Motor Design Engineer typically requires a strong background in electrical or mechanical engineering, motor theory, and substantial experience in electromagnetics and thermal analysis. Expertise with simulation tools such as ANSYS Maxwell, MATLAB, and CAD software, as well as familiarity with industry standards or certifications (e.g., IEEE), is commonly expected. Strong project management,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ication with multidisciplinary teams help these engineers excel. These skills ensure the successful design, development, and optimization of advanced motor systems to meet demanding project requirements.

Curtiss-Wright Industrial Division, which includes the legacy brands of Arens Controls, Penny & Giles, PG Drives Technology and Williams Controls, is an excellent supplier in providing components and sub-systems which enable customer specific solutions for on- and off-highway vehicles. These include medium- and heavy-duty trucks, buses and motor coaches, construction and agricultural vehicles, materials handling, and other specialty vehicles, as well as sophisticated wheelchairs and scooters for medical mobility.
Arens Controls products comprise state-of-the-art drivetrain components, such as 'by-wire' and mechanical transmission shifters, as well as electronic control systems for the Hybrid Electronic Vehicle (HEV) market.
The products are the legacy of the Arens Controls company founded in 1939 and acquired by Curtiss-Wright in 2013.

Curtiss-Wright Actuation Division designs, manufactures and supports electro-mechanical actuation products and systems for use in demanding applications in Aerospace, Defense and Industrial Automation markets. Our market leading solutions help improve the reliability, efficiency and performance of our customers' operations and platforms, as well as reducing their environmental impact with energy efficient electro-mechanical designs and technology. For the Aerospace market, we supply actuation systems for flight control, landing gear, utility and other applications on both commercial and military aircraft. In Ground & Naval Defense markets, we support a wide array of applications ranging from door assist, ramp and hatch actuation, weapons handling systems, radar and launch platform actuation, and robotic (AUV/ROV) actuation. In Industrial Automation, our Exlar® actuators are globally recognized as a leading brand offering high power density, precision and reliability for machine/process applications in automotive, food & beverage, oil & gas, robotics, entertainment and many other industries.
